Default problem with Castle side winder speed control

I just bought the castle side winder 1/10 sport brushless combo. My problem is I cant set it up right. I hold my throttle down on my transmitter, then turn on speed control. it beeps for the full throttle but doesnt for the full brake or neautral. what am I doing wrong. some help please. I am new to this electric onroad stuff.

You aren't doing anything wrong; it's the electronics you chose to install in your touring car. In this case, the arming time for the speed control is not long enough for the Spektrum radio system. When the Spektrum Radio is swtiched on, it needs a moment to "talk" to the receiver to locate a clear frequency. This ends up being longer than the default arming time of the Sidewinder speed control, which is 1.5 seconds. This issue is easy to resolve thanks to the programmability Castle Creations builds into its speed controls. The arming time in the Sidewinder is adjustable and can be simply accessed with Castle Creations Castle Link. The default arming time is 1.5 seconds, try switching to 2.5 seconds.

I've had this problem before with it too....Even the guys at my LHS couldn't figure out...I found the solution in Radio Control Car Action magazine...it was a coincidence, I was reading it and found out about this problem and finally fixed it after purchasing the Castle Link.
